About Liberty Broadband

Liberty Broadband (LBRDA) is a prominent media and communications company with a significant portfolio of broadband and content businesses. The company holds substantial investments in Charter Communications, one of the largest broadband providers in the United States, as well as ownership stakes in other cable networks and digital media ventures. Liberty Broadband's strategy focuses on growing its existing investments and pursuing strategic opportunities within the evolving telecommunications and media landscape. Its operations are geared towards delivering essential broadband services and leveraging its content assets.


The Class C common stock of Liberty Broadband represents a class of its equity securities. The company's structure allows for distinct classes of stock, each with its own voting and economic rights. This tiered equity structure is a hallmark of the Liberty Media model, enabling strategic flexibility and capital management. Liberty Broadband's business model is designed to generate value through its diverse holdings and its active management of these assets.

Liberty Broadband Corporation Class C Common Stock Financial Outlook and Forecast

Liberty Broadband Corporation (LBRDA) operates within the dynamic telecommunications sector, primarily through its significant investment in Charter Communications. The company's financial outlook is intrinsically linked to the performance of its core holdings and the broader trends in broadband and cable services. LBRDA's revenue generation is largely dependent on the dividend income and capital appreciation derived from its Charter stake. Charter, a leading broadband connectivity provider, faces a market characterized by increasing competition from fixed wireless access (FWA) and fiber optic network expansion by rivals. However, Charter also benefits from its established infrastructure, extensive customer base, and its ability to bundle services, including high-speed internet, video, and voice. The demand for robust and reliable internet connectivity, driven by remote work, streaming entertainment, and an increasing number of connected devices, continues to provide a foundational support for LBRDA's financial prospects.


Looking ahead, LBRDA's financial forecast is subject to several key macroeconomic and industry-specific factors. The ongoing investment in infrastructure upgrades by Charter, aimed at enhancing network capacity and speed, is crucial for maintaining a competitive edge and potentially attracting new subscribers. This investment, while necessary, also presents a significant capital expenditure. Furthermore, the regulatory environment surrounding telecommunications, including net neutrality policies and potential antitrust scrutiny, could impact the profitability and strategic flexibility of Charter, and consequently, LBRDA. Subscriber growth and churn rates within the cable industry will remain a primary determinant of Charter's revenue performance. The company's ability to innovate and adapt its service offerings, perhaps by expanding into new areas like mobile services or smart home solutions, will be critical for sustained financial health.
